PGSS reports fifth COVID-19 exposure

Prince George Secondary School has been listed a fifth time for possible COVID-19 exposure.

Northern Health says it occurred between February 8 and 9.

This is the 21st school exposure in the Prince George area.

Staff and students are asked to monitor for any possible symptoms until Tuesday.
